git切换到另外一个分支

不及物动词 其他 115

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    切换到另外一个分支可以通过git checkout命令来完成。具体步骤如下:

    1. 首先,使用git branch命令查看当前仓库中存在的分支,确认需要切换到的分支是存在的。例如,如果我们想要切换到名为”feature”的分支,可以执行以下命令:
    “`
    git branch
    “`
    这将列出所有存在的分支,当前所在的分支会以星号(*)标记。

    2. 使用git checkout命令切换到目标分支。执行以下命令:
    “`
    git checkout feature
    “`
    这将把当前分支切换到”feature”分支。

    3. 如果需要在切换分支时保存当前工作区的修改,可以使用git stash命令。执行以下命令:
    “`
    git stash
    “`
    这将把当前工作区的修改保存到堆栈中。完成切换后,可以使用git stash pop命令来恢复之前保存的修改。

    总结:
    切换到另外一个分支可以通过以下步骤完成:
    1. 使用git branch命令查看当前存在的分支。
    2. 使用git checkout命令切换到目标分支。
    3. 如有需要,使用git stash命令保存当前工作区的修改。完成切换后,可以使用git stash pop命令来恢复之前保存的修改。

    希望以上内容对您有所帮助!如有其他问题,请随时向我提问。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在git中,要切换到另一个分支,可以使用git checkout命令。以下是关于切换分支的五个重要方面:

    1. 查看可用分支:使用git branch命令可以查看当前仓库中存在的所有分支。命令行中会列出所有的分支,以及当前所在的分支会用特殊的标记进行标注。

    2. 切换分支:使用git checkout 命令可以切换到另一个分支。在命令行中,将替换为你想要切换的分支的名称。例如,要切换到名为feature的分支,可以输入git checkout feature。

    3. 创建并切换到新的分支:有时候,你可能想要创建一个新的分支并立即切换到它。可以使用git checkout -b 命令来完成这个操作。该命令将创建一个名为的新分支,并立即切换到它。例如,要创建并切换到名为bugfix的新分支,可以输入git checkout -b bugfix。

    4. 临时保存工作:如果你在当前分支上进行了一些未完成的工作,但需要切换到另一个分支以处理其他任务,则可以使用git stash命令临时保存当前工作。git stash命令会将当前修改的内容保存到一个栈中,并将工作目录恢复到上一个提交的状态。可以使用git stash pop命令来恢复之前保存的工作并应用到当前分支。

    5. 切换到远程分支:除了切换到本地分支,你还可以切换到远程分支,以查看和修改远程分支上的代码。首先,使用git fetch命令从远程仓库中获取最新的分支信息。然后,使用git checkout /命令切换到所需的分支。其中,是远程仓库的名称,是远程分支的名称。例如,要切换到名为origin/master的远程分支,可以输入git checkout origin/master。

    总之,使用git checkout命令可以方便地切换到另一个分支,无论是本地分支还是远程分支。这是一个非常有用的功能,可以帮助你有效地管理和开发你的代码库。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在使用Git进行版本控制时,切换到另一个分支是一个常见的操作。下面是在Git中切换到另一个分支的方法和操作流程。

    1. 首先,使用`git branch`命令查看当前的分支。这将列出所有本地分支,当前所在的分支会用星号标记。

    “`bash
    $ git branch
    * master
    branch1
    branch2
    “`

    2. 使用`git checkout`命令切换到另一个分支。例如,要切换到`branch1`分支,可以运行以下命令:

    “`bash
    $ git checkout branch1
    Switched to branch ‘branch1’
    “`

    3. 如果想要创建并切换到一个新分支,可以使用`git checkout -b`命令。例如,要创建并切换到一个名为`branch3`的新分支,可以运行以下命令:

    “`bash
    $ git checkout -b branch3
    Switched to a new branch ‘branch3’
    “`

    该命令等效于以下两个命令的组合:

    “`bash
    $ git branch branch3
    $ git checkout branch3
    “`

    4. 切换分支后,可以通过运行`git branch`命令再次确认当前所在的分支。

    “`bash
    $ git branch
    master
    branch1
    * branch3
    branch2
    “`

    注意事项:
    – 在切换分支之前,确保当前分支的工作已经提交或保存,以免丢失更改。
    – 分支切换后,工作目录会自动切换到所切换的分支的最新状态,包括文件的添加、删除和修改。

    总结:使用`git checkout`命令可以轻松切换到另一个分支。如果要创建并切换到一个新分支,可以使用`git checkout -b`命令。切换分支前,确保当前分支的工作已保存或提交,以免丢失更改。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部